Zinc/Copper Ratio – What It Means on a Hair Mineral Test
The Zinc/Copper (Zn/Cu) Ratio is one of the most clinically significant mineral ratios on a Hair Tissue Mineral Analysis (HTMA) test. Zinc and copper are both essential trace minerals that need to be kept in balance for optimal immune function, inflammation control, hormone regulation, and nervous system stability.
Even when your individual zinc and copper levels fall within their respective reference ranges, the ratio between them can reveal deeper insights into your metabolic, neurological, and immune health.
What Does the Zinc/Copper Ratio Reflect?
-
Zinc is involved in over 300 enzyme systems and plays a central role in immune function, wound healing, antioxidant defense (CuZnSOD), testosterone production, and brain chemistry.
-
Copper is critical for iron transport, energy production (cytochrome c oxidase), connective tissue health, and neurotransmitter regulation (especially dopamine and norepinephrine).
The Zn/Cu Ratio reflects the balance between zinc’s stabilizing, calming effects and copper’s stimulating, activating roles. It is sometimes referred to as the “emotional regulation” or “neurotransmitter balance” ratio due to its influence on mood, focus, and stress resilience.
Optimal Zn/Cu Ratio
-
A healthy Zn/Cu ratio typically falls between 6 and 12:1 on most HTMA reports.
-
Ratios outside this range—especially when chronic—can indicate hidden imbalances affecting mental health, inflammation, or detoxification pathways.
High Zinc/Copper Ratio – What It May Indicate
A high Zn/Cu ratio usually means zinc is elevated relative to copper. This can result from:
-
Excessive zinc supplementation, often unbalanced with copper
-
Copper deficiency, impairing iron metabolism and neurotransmitter production
-
Adrenal fatigue or suppressed metabolic function
Possible symptoms of high Zn/Cu ratio:
-
Fatigue, poor energy production
-
Anemia (due to low copper affecting iron transport)
-
Low white blood cell count or frequent infections
-
Low dopamine/norepinephrine (mood and focus issues)
-
Skin issues or connective tissue fragility
-
Low estrogen/progesterone in women or low testosterone in men
Low Zinc/Copper Ratio – What It May Indicate
A low Zn/Cu ratio suggests copper is dominant relative to zinc, and is one of the most common imbalances seen on HTMA panels—especially in those with:
-
Chronic stress or trauma history
-
Estrogen dominance
-
Neuroinflammatory or mood-related symptoms
Possible symptoms of low Zn/Cu ratio:
-
Anxiety, panic attacks, or racing thoughts
-
Brain fog, memory loss, or ADHD-like symptoms
-
Depression or irritability
-
Poor detoxification (copper overload stresses the liver)
-
Skin conditions (e.g., acne, eczema)
-
PMS or hormonal imbalances
In some cases, this pattern is referred to as “functional copper toxicity,” where total copper may not be elevated in the blood, but copper is poorly regulated or bio-unavailable.
How the Ratio Is Interpreted
| Zinc/Copper Ratio | Possible Interpretation |
|---|---|
| High Zn/Cu Ratio (>12) | Possible copper deficiency, over-supplementation of zinc, fatigue, immune suppression |
| Low Zn/Cu Ratio (<6) | Functional copper dominance, neuroinflammation, mood disorders, hormonal imbalance |
Note: The ratio must be interpreted alongside absolute levels and symptoms. For example, a normal ratio can mask low levels of both zinc and copper.

What does it mean if your Zinc/Copper Ratio result is too high?
An elevated Zinc/Copper (Zn/Cu) Ratio on a Hair Tissue Mineral Analysis (HTMA) test means that zinc is relatively high compared to copper in your tissues. This ratio reflects a dynamic balance between two essential trace minerals, and when zinc significantly outweighs copper, it may signal copper deficiency, zinc over-supplementation, or issues with immune and energy regulation.
What an Elevated Zinc/Copper Ratio May Indicate
1. Copper Deficiency or Poor Copper Utilization
Copper plays a vital role in:
-
Iron metabolism (via ceruloplasmin)
-
Neurotransmitter balance (dopamine, norepinephrine)
-
Connective tissue formation
-
Energy production (cytochrome oxidase in mitochondria)
When copper is too low relative to zinc, it can lead to fatigue, poor immune defense, low iron levels, and altered brain chemistry—especially affecting mood and focus.
2. Zinc Overload from Supplements
Chronic or high-dose zinc supplementation (typically >30–50 mg/day) can drive this ratio up by:
-
Suppressing copper absorption (zinc and copper compete in the gut)
-
Inducing secondary copper deficiency
-
Altering immune and inflammatory responses
Even moderate zinc supplementation, if not balanced with copper, can distort this ratio over time.
3. Suppressed Metabolic or Immune Activity
Zinc has a calming, stabilizing effect on metabolism. When zinc is dominant and copper is low, it may reflect:
-
A “slow oxidizer” pattern (reduced metabolic rate)
-
Immune suppression or low white blood cell activity
-
Adrenal fatigue or mitochondrial under-functioning
Symptoms That May Be Linked to a High Zn/Cu Ratio
-
Fatigue or poor energy production
-
Frequent infections or slow wound healing
-
Cold sensitivity
-
Low motivation or apathy
-
Anemia (iron not efficiently transported without copper)
-
Poor memory or cognitive sluggishness
-
Reduced sex hormone synthesis (zinc dominance may suppress estrogen)
Clinical Relevance
An elevated Zn/Cu ratio is often under-recognized but can have widespread physiological effects, especially on:
-
Mood and mental health: Low copper impairs dopamine and norepinephrine synthesis
-
Immune function: Zinc suppresses excess immune activation, but without copper, white blood cell production may suffer
-
Iron metabolism: Copper is needed for iron transport; deficiency can mimic iron-deficiency anemia

What does it mean if your Zinc/Copper Ratio result is too low?
What Does a Decreased Zinc/Copper Ratio Mean in Hair Mineral Analysis?
A decreased Zinc/Copper (Zn/Cu) ratio means that copper levels are elevated relative to zinc levels, or zinc levels are insufficient to balance copper. This imbalance can have significant implications for physical and mental health, as zinc and copper work in tandem to regulate key processes in the body.
Possible Causes of a Decreased Zinc/Copper Ratio
-
Copper Toxicity
- Sources of Excess Copper:
Environmental exposure (e.g., copper water pipes, cookware, pesticides) or high dietary copper intake (shellfish, nuts, seeds) can lead to elevated copper levels. - Hormonal Influence:
Hormonal contraceptives or estrogen dominance may increase copper retention.
- Sources of Excess Copper:
-
Zinc Deficiency
- Dietary Deficiency:
Poor zinc intake, often seen with diets low in animal proteins or high in processed foods. - Malabsorption:
Conditions like celiac disease, Crohn's disease, or gut dysbiosis can impair zinc absorption. - Excessive Zinc Loss:
Chronic stress, alcohol consumption, or excessive sweating may deplete zinc stores.
- Dietary Deficiency:
-
Chronic Inflammation or Stress
Elevated copper levels can result from chronic stress or inflammation, as copper is mobilized from tissues to support enzyme systems involved in inflammatory and stress responses. -
Heavy Metal Toxicity
The presence of heavy metals, such as mercury or cadmium, may disrupt zinc and copper metabolism, further lowering the Zn/Cu ratio.
Potential Symptoms of a Low Zinc/Copper Ratio
- Mental Health Challenges:
Anxiety, depression, irritability, or mood swings due to copper’s effect on neurotransmitter function. - Immune Dysregulation:
Frequent infections or slow healing, as zinc is essential for immune function. - Fatigue:
Imbalances in copper and zinc may impair energy production. - Hormonal Imbalances:
Symptoms of estrogen dominance (e.g., PMS, irregular periods) linked to high copper levels. - Cognitive Issues:
Brain fog, memory problems, or difficulty concentrating. - Skin Conditions:
Acne, eczema, or other skin irritations.
Health Implications of a Decreased Zn/Cu Ratio
-
Oxidative Stress:
Excess copper can act as a pro-oxidant, contributing to free radical damage and cellular stress. -
Neurotransmitter Imbalance:
High copper levels disrupt the balance of dopamine and norepinephrine, which can lead to anxiety or hyperactivity. -
Immune Dysfunction:
Insufficient zinc weakens immune defenses, making the body more susceptible to infections. -
Hormonal Dysregulation:
A decreased ratio is often linked to estrogen dominance, which may exacerbate symptoms like heavy menstrual bleeding or fibroids.
